Output e75e5e78d6b6ef06a4ef41fe244fdd7fdaf56fb4347a32e4cab0d0e21114ab3d:3

value
175683
script pubkey
OP_0 OP_PUSHBYTES_20 3bbb3fe620312a6366579710d43f57ff60fb11a7
address
bc1q8wanle3qxy4xxejhjugdg06hlas0kyd84pcyll
transaction
e75e5e78d6b6ef06a4ef41fe244fdd7fdaf56fb4347a32e4cab0d0e21114ab3d
spent
true